A tool for energy conversion helps users determine the kilowatt-hours (kWh) equivalent of a battery’s capacity expressed in ampere-hours (Ah). This conversion requires knowledge of the battery’s voltage. For instance, a 100 Ah battery with a voltage of 12V has a capacity of 1.2 kWh (100 Ah * 12 V / 1000). This information is vital for comparing different battery systems and understanding their potential energy output.

Understanding the energy storage capabilities of batteries is essential for various applications, from sizing off-grid power systems to evaluating electric vehicle range. Historically, battery capacity was primarily communicated in ampere-hours, a metric focusing on current delivery over time. However, with the growing importance of energy storage, kilowatt-hours have become increasingly relevant for directly comparing energy content across different battery chemistries and voltages. This conversion facilitates informed decisions regarding energy consumption and system design. The ability to readily convert between these units provides a clearer picture of a battery’s true energy potential, enabling more effective management and utilization of energy resources.

Power, measured in watts, represents the rate at which energy is used or generated. Energy consumption over time is quantified in watt-hours. A tool that facilitates conversion between these two units takes power consumption (watts) and duration of use (hours) as inputs to calculate total energy consumed (watt-hours). For instance, a 100-watt light bulb operating for 5 hours consumes 500 watt-hours of energy.

Understanding energy consumption is crucial for managing electricity costs, optimizing energy efficiency, and designing power systems. Accurately converting between power and energy allows for informed decisions about appliance usage, renewable energy generation, and battery storage capacity. This capability has become increasingly important with the rise of energy-conscious practices and the growing adoption of renewable energy sources.

Project labor estimation involves determining the total time required, expressed in person-hours, to complete a specific task or project. For example, if five individuals work on a project for eight hours each, the project requires 40 person-hours (5 people x 8 hours = 40 person-hours).

Accurate time estimation is crucial for project planning, budgeting, resource allocation, and performance evaluation. Historically, labor estimation has evolved from basic guesswork to sophisticated methods involving data analysis and specialized software. Effective estimation minimizes cost overruns, ensures timely completion, and facilitates optimal resource utilization, leading to increased profitability and efficiency.

Time clocks that calculate hours are devices used to track the time an employee works. They are typically used in workplaces to ensure that employees are paid accurately for their time worked.

Time clocks that calculate hours can be either mechanical or electronic. Mechanical time clocks use a punch card that is inserted into the clock to record the employee’s time. Electronic time clocks use a biometric scanner to record the employee’s fingerprint or other unique identifier.

Converting engine operation time to an estimated distance traveled can be a valuable tool for vehicle maintenance, operational logistics, and resale value assessment. For example, comparing the recorded operating time of a marine engine with a typical cruising speed allows for an approximation of distance covered. This method offers a valuable alternative to odometer readings, which may be unavailable or unreliable in certain applications like marine vessels, construction equipment, or aircraft.

This conversion provides essential data for scheduling preventative maintenance based on usage rather than mileage. It also allows for more accurate estimations of operating costs related to fuel consumption and component wear. Historically, relying solely on odometer readings proved inadequate for applications where engine use varies significantly in speed and load. The development of this conversion method enhances the ability to track usage effectively, leading to improved maintenance practices and cost-benefit analysis.

A metric representing the total time spent by a workforce on a specific task or project is calculated by multiplying the number of individuals working by the duration of their effort, typically expressed in hours. For example, a project requiring five people working eight hours each would represent 40 units of work. This metric facilitates precise estimations of labor costs, project scheduling, and resource allocation.

Accurate quantification of labor is crucial for effective project management and budget control. Historical data on labor expenditure enables more realistic forecasting for future endeavors and provides valuable benchmarks for evaluating efficiency and productivity. Understanding these metrics aids in optimizing resource allocation, improving productivity, and enhancing profitability across various sectors, from manufacturing and software development to research and customer service.
